PURPOSE: To analyze final long-term survival and clinical outcomes from the randomized phase III study of sunitinib in gastrointestinal stromal tumor patients after imatinib failure; to assess correlative angiogenesis biomarkers with patient outcomes. EXPERIMENTAL DESIGN: Blinded sunitinib or placebo was given daily on a 4-week-on/2-week-off treatment schedule. Placebo-assigned patients could cross over to sunitinib at disease progression/study unblinding. Overall survival (OS) was analyzed using conventional statistical methods and the rank-preserving structural failure time (RPSFT) method to explore cross-over impact. Circulating levels of angiogenesis biomarkers were analyzed. RESULTS: In total, 243 patients were randomized to receive sunitinib and 118 to placebo, 103 of whom crossed over to open-label sunitinib. Conventional statistical analysis showed that OS converged in the sunitinib and placebo arms (median 72.7 vs. 64.9 weeks; HR, 0.876; P = 0.306) as expected, given the cross-over design. RPSFT analysis estimated median OS for placebo of 39.0 weeks (HR, 0.505, 95% CI, 0.262-1.134; P = 0.306). No new safety concerns emerged with extended sunitinib treatment. No consistent associations were found between the pharmacodynamics of angiogenesis-related plasma proteins during sunitinib treatment and clinical outcome. CONCLUSIONS: The cross-over design provided evidence of sunitinib clinical benefit based on prolonged time to tumor progression during the double-blind phase of this trial. As expected, following cross-over, there was no statistical difference in OS. RPSFT analysis modeled the absence of cross-over, estimating a substantial sunitinib OS benefit relative to placebo. Long-term sunitinib treatment was tolerated without new adverse events.

BACKGROUND:: Mechanical forces play an important role in tissue neovascularization and are a constituent part of modern wound therapies. The mechanisms by which vacuum assisted closure (VAC) modulates wound angiogenesis are still largely unknown. OBJECTIVE:: To investigate how VAC treatment affects wound hypoxia and related profiles of angiogenic factors as well as to identify the anatomical characteristics of the resultant, newly formed vessels. METHODS:: Wound neovascularization was evaluated by morphometric analysis of CD31-stained wound cross-sections as well as by corrosion casting analysis. Wound hypoxia and mRNA expression of HIF-1α and associated angiogenic factors were evaluated by pimonidazole hydrochloride staining and quantitative reverse transcription-polymerase chain reaction (RT-PCR), respectively. Vascular endothelial growth factor (VEGF) protein levels were determined by western blot analysis. RESULTS:: VAC-treated wounds were characterized by the formation of elongated vessels aligned in parallel and consistent with physiologically function, compared to occlusive dressing control wounds that showed formation of tortuous, disoriented vessels. Moreover, VAC-treated wounds displayed a well-oxygenated wound bed, with hypoxia limited to the direct proximity of the VAC-foam interface, where higher VEGF levels were found. By contrast, occlusive dressing control wounds showed generalized hypoxia, with associated accumulation of HIF-1α and related angiogenic factors. CONCLUSIONS:: The combination of established gradients of hypoxia and VEGF expression along with mechanical forces exerted by VAC therapy was associated with the formation of more physiological blood vessels compared to occlusive dressing control wounds. These morphological changes are likely a necessary condition for better wound healing.

La thrombocytopénie immune primaire (ITP) est une affection auto-immune acquise avec diminution de la survie des plaquettes et perturbation de la production plaquettaire. Il n'existe aucun test clinique simple permettant de prouver la nature auto-immune de l'affection. Pour cette raison, il s'agit presque toujours d'un diagnostic par exclusion d'autres causes. Bien que les plaquettes soient souvent inférieures à 10 x 109/l lors de la présentation initiale, la tendance hémorragique est étonnamment modérée chez la majorité des patients. Le traitement initial fait toujours appel aux corticostéroïdes, combinés à des immunoglobulines intraveineuses et à des transfusions de plaquettes dans les formes compliquées avec hémorragies significatives. Chez l'enfant, la maladie est souvent induite par des infections virales et son évolution est bénigne et spontanément régressive dans la majorité des cas. Chez l'adulte, la maladie est plus souvent persistante ou chroniquement récidivante, et le taux de plaquettes se situe souvent à un taux suffisant pour prévenir des hémorragies spontanées. Seule une faible proportion de patients souffre d'une thrombocytopénie sévère prolongée accompagnée de saignements réguliers avec risque d'hémorragies potentiellement fatales. C'est probablement ce groupe de patients restreint qui tirera surtout profit des nouvelles options thérapeutiques telles que les agonistes du récepteur de la thrombopoïétine. A la lumière de ces nouvelles possibilités, un groupe d'hématologues suisses s'est réuni pour élaborer des directives concernant la prise en charge de l'ITP conformément aux besoins et aux habitudes de notre pays.

Par Compliance, on entend l'ensemble des mesures organisationnelles d'une entreprise qui visent à assurer le respect des règles par l'entreprise et ses collaborateurs. Dans le secteur privé - surtout dans les banques et les assurances - la Compliance est un concept bien établi et le poste du Compliance Officer apparaît clairement dans l'organigramme des entreprises. Ce terme apparaît aussi de temps à autre au sein de l'administration fédérale, en relation avec la politique de gestion des risques et le système de contrôle interne (SCI) ; mais une introduction effective de la Compliance n'y a pas encore eu lieu (jusqu'ici). Les Américains ont l'habitude de dire « if you think compliance is expensive, try non compliance ». Cette déclaration, apparemment valable pour le secteur privé, peut-elle cependant être transposée telle quelle au secteur public ? L'introduction d'un système de management tel que la Compliance apporterait-elle effectivement une plus-value par rapport aux systèmes existants afin d'éviter les risques engendrant des conséquences juridiques ou causant une mauvaise réputation suite au non-respect de règles par des collaborateurs ? La présente étude se penche sur ces questions et analyse, sur la base de documents et d'interviews, quels éléments de la Compliance existent au niveau de la Confédération et au sein de l'Office fédéral de la santé publique (OFSP) et s'ils sont propres à atteindre les objectifs visés par la Compliance. Dans plusieurs domaines, on a pu constater des défauts et, par conséquent, un gros potentiel d'amélioration. Le problème principal est l'absence d'organisation au niveau de la Compliance. Cela complique la vue d'ensemble des risques juridiques et de ceux pouvant causer une mauvaise réputation qui existent au niveau de la Confédération et à l'OFSP et rend impossible un management homogène de ces risques. En conséquence et dans l'état actuel des choses, il pourrait s'avérer difficile d'éviter de manière durable la réalisation des risques susmentionnés au moyen des systèmes existants. D'un autre côté, la politique de gestion des risques au sein de la Confédération et l'introduction d'un système de contrôle interne (SCI) ont représenté les premiers pas en direction d'un système de gestion des risques intégré. La Compliance serait un complément idéal et pourrait - dans la mesure où la direction de l'Office la soutient et donne le bon exemple - contribuer à la réduction des risques décrits ci-dessus non seulement au niveau de la Confédération mais encore au sein de l'OFSP. La présente étude ne vise pas pour autant à critiquer les systèmes établis, mais bien plus à montrer le potentiel d'amélioration dont on pourrait tirer profit.

Cancer development results from deregulated control of stem cell populations and alterations in their surrounding environment. Notch signaling is an important form of direct cell-cell communication involved in cell fate determination, stem cell potential and lineage commitment. The biological function of this pathway is critically context dependent. Here we review the pro-differentiation role and tumor suppressing function of this pathway, as revealed by loss-of-function in keratinocytes and skin, downstream of p53 and in cross-connection with other determinants of stem cell potential and/or tumor formation, such as p63 and Rho/CDC42 effectors. The possibility that Notch signaling elicits a duality of signals, involved in growth/differentiation control and cell survival will be discussed, in the context of novel approaches for cancer therapy

L'expert, en présence d'une signature contestée qu'il juge authentique, peut être confronté à l'argument selon lequel il pourrait s'agir d'une imitation parfaite. Les différents facteurs pouvant avoir un impact sur cette possibilité sont inventoriés et discutés dans cet article. Il s'agit principalement d'éléments liés soit à la signature en tant que telle, par exemple sa complexité et son degré de variation, soit à l'imitateur putatif, en particulier ses compétences. Pour répondre à la question d'un magistrat sur la possibilité de se trouver face à une imitation parfaite, l'expert sera armé pour écarter la simple explication que représente l'imitation parfaite au profit d'une discussion des résultats balancée et cohérente, où l'ensemble de ces facteurs sont discutés dans un cadre d'évaluation probabiliste.

QUESTION UNDER STUDY: To investigate the change over time in the number of ED admissions with positive blood alcohol concentration (BAC) and to evaluate predictors of BAC level. METHODS: We conducted a single site retrospective study at the ED of a tertiary referral hospital (western part of Switzerland) and obtained all the BAC performed from 2002 to 2011. We determined the proportion of ED admissions with positive BAC (number of positive BAC/number of admissions). Regression models assessed trends in the proportion of admissions with positive BAC and the predictors of BAC level among patients with positive BAC. RESULTS: A total of 319,489 admissions were recorded and 20,021 BAC tests were performed, of which 14,359 were positive, divided 34.5% female and 65.5% male. The mean (SD) age was 41.7(16.8), and the mean BAC was 2.12(1.04) permille (g of ethanol/liter of blood). An increase in the number of positive BAC was observed, from 756 in 2002 to 1,819 in 2011. The total number of admissions also increased but less: 1.2 versus 2.4 times more admissions with positive BAC. Being male was independently associated with a higher (+0.19 permille) BAC, as was each passing year (+0.03). A significant quadratic association with age indicated a maximum BAC at age 53. CONCLUSION: We observed an increase in the percentage of admissions with positive BAC that was not limited to younger individuals. Given the potential consequences of alcohol intoxication, and the large burden imposed on ED teams, communities should be encouraged to take measures aimed at reducing alcohol intoxication.

Myocardial angiogenesis induction with vascular growth factors constitutes a potential strategy for patients whose coronary artery disease is refractory to conventional treatment. The importance of angiogenesis in bone formation has led to the development of growth factors derived from bovine bone protein. Twelve pigs (mean weight, 73 +/- 3 kg) were chosen for the study. In the first group (n = 6, growth factor group) five 100 micrograms boluses of growth factors derived from bovine bone protein, diluted in Povidone 5%, were injected in the lateral wall of the left ventricle. In the second group (n = 6, control group), the same operation was performed but only the diluting agent was injected. All the animals were sacrificed after 28 days and the vascular density of the left lateral wall (expressed as the number of vascular structures per mm2) as well as the area of blood vessel profiles per myocardial area analysed were determined histologically with a computerised system. The growth factor group had a capillary density which was significantly higher than that of the control group: 12.6 +/- 0.9/mm2 vs 4.8 +/- 0.5/mm2 (p < 0.01). The same holds true for the arteriolar density: 1 +/- 0.2/mm2 vs 0.3 +/- 0.1/mm2 (p < 0.01). The surface ratios of blood vessel profiles per myocardial area were 4900 +/- 800 micron 2/mm2 and 1550 +/- 400 micron 2/mm2 (p < 0.01) respectively. In this experimental model, bovine bone protein derived growth factors induce a significant neovascularisation in healthy myocardium, and appear therefore as promising candidates for therapeutic angiogenesis.

Peroxisome proliferator-activated receptors control many cellular and metabolic processes. They are transcription factors belonging to the family of ligand-inducible nuclear receptors. Three isotypes called PPARalpha, PPARbeta/delta and PPARgamma have been identified in lower vertebrates and mammals. They display differential tissue distribution and each of the three isotypes fulfills specific functions. PPARalpha and PPARgamma control energy homoeostasis and inflammatory responses. Their activity can be modulated by drugs such as the hypolipidaemic fibrates and the insulin sensitising thiazolidinediones (pioglitazone and rosiglitazone). Thus, these receptors are involved in the control of chronic diseases such as diabetes, obesity, and atherosclerosis. Little is known about the main function of PPARbeta, but it has been implicated in embryo implantation, tumorigenesis in the colon, reverse cholesterol transport, and recently in skin wound healing. Here, we present recent developments in the PPAR field with particular emphasis on both the function of PPARs in lipid metabolism and energy homoeostasis (PPARalpha and PPARgamma), and their role in epidermal maturation and skin wound repair (PPARalpha and PPARbeta).

Many disorders are associated with altered serum protein concentrations, including malnutrition, cancer, and cardiovascular, kidney, and inflammatory diseases. Although these protein concentrations are highly heritable, relatively little is known about their underlying genetic determinants. Through transethnic meta-analysis of European-ancestry and Japanese genome-wide association studies, we identified six loci at genome-wide significance (p < 5 × 10(-8)) for serum albumin (HPN-SCN1B, GCKR-FNDC4, SERPINF2-WDR81, TNFRSF11A-ZCCHC2, FRMD5-WDR76, and RPS11-FCGRT, in up to 53,190 European-ancestry and 9,380 Japanese individuals) and three loci for total protein (TNFRS13B, 6q21.3, and ELL2, in up to 25,539 European-ancestry and 10,168 Japanese individuals). We observed little evidence of heterogeneity in allelic effects at these loci between groups of European and Japanese ancestry but obtained substantial improvements in the resolution of fine mapping of potential causal variants by leveraging transethnic differences in the distribution of linkage disequilibrium. We demonstrated a functional role for the most strongly associated serum albumin locus, HPN, for which Hpn knockout mice manifest low plasma albumin concentrations. Other loci associated with serum albumin harbor genes related to ribosome function, protein translation, and proteasomal degradation, whereas those associated with serum total protein include genes related to immune function. Our results highlight the advantages of transethnic meta-analysis for the discovery and fine mapping of complex trait loci and have provided initial insights into the underlying genetic architecture of serum protein concentrations and their association with human disease.

BACKGROUND: Pharmacy-based case mix measures are an alternative source of information to the relatively scarce outpatient diagnoses data. But most published tools use national drug nomenclatures and offer no head-to-head comparisons between drugs-related and diagnoses-based categories. The objective of the study was to test the accuracy of drugs-based morbidity groups derived from the World Health Organization Anatomical Therapeutic Chemical Classification of drugs by checking them against diagnoses-based groups. METHODS: We compared drugs-based categories with their diagnoses-based analogues using anonymous data on 108,915 individuals insured with one of four companies. They were followed throughout 2005 and 2006 and hospitalized at least once during this period. The agreement between the two approaches was measured by weighted kappa coefficients. The reproducibility of the drugs-based morbidity measure over the 2 years was assessed for all enrollees. RESULTS: Eighty percent used a drug associated with at least one of the 60 morbidity categories derived from drugs dispensation. After accounting for inpatient under-coding, fifteen conditions agreed sufficiently with their diagnoses-based counterparts to be considered alternative strategies to diagnoses. In addition, they exhibited good reproducibility and allowed prevalence estimates in accordance with national estimates. For 22 conditions, drugs-based information identified accurately a subset of the population defined by diagnoses. CONCLUSIONS: Most categories provide insurers with health status information that could be exploited for healthcare expenditure prediction or ambulatory cost control, especially when ambulatory diagnoses are not available. However, due to insufficient concordance with their diagnoses-based analogues, their use for morbidity indicators is limited.

Mitral regurgitation (MR) involves systolic retrograde flow from the left ventricle into the left atrium. While trivial MR is frequent in healthy subjects, moderate to severe MR constitutes the second most prevalent valve disease after aortic valve stenosis. Major causes of severe MR in Western countries include degenerative valve disease (myxomatous disease, flail leaflet, annular calcification) and ischaemic heart disease, while rheumatic disease remains a major cause of MR in developing countries. Chronic MR typically progresses insidiously over many years. Once established, however, severe MR portends a poor prognosis. The severity of MR can be assessed by various techniques, Doppler echocardiography being the most widely used. Mitral valve surgery is the only treatment of proven efficacy. It alleviates clinical symptoms and prevents ventricular dilatation and heart failure (or, at least, it attenuates further progression of these abnormalities). Valve repair significantly improves clinical outcomes compared with valve replacement, reducing mortality by approximately 70%. Reverse LV remodelling after valve repair occurs in half of patients with functional MR. Percutaneous, catheter-based to mitral valve repair is a novel approach currently under clinical scrutiny, with encouraging preliminary results. This modality may provide a valuable alternative to mitral valve surgery, especially in critically ill patients.

Vax1 and Vax2 have been implicated in eye development and the closure of the choroid fissure in mice and zebrafish. We sequenced the coding exons of VAX1 and VAX2 in 70 patients with anophthalmia/microphthalmia. In VAX1, we observed homozygosity for two successive nucleotide substitutions c.453G>A and c.454C>A, predicting p.Arg152Ser, in a proband of Egyptian origin with microphthalmia, small optic nerves, cleft lip/palate and corpus callosum agenesis. This mutation affects an invariant residue in the homeodomain of VAX1 and was absent from 96 Egyptian controls. It is likely that the mutation results in a loss of function, as the mutation results in a phenotype similar to the Vax1 homozygous null mouse. We did not identify any mutations in VAX2. This is the first description of a phenotype associated with a VAX1 mutation in humans and establishes VAX1 as a new causative gene for anophthalmia/microphthalmia. ©2011 Wiley Periodicals, Inc.

Therapeutic drug monitoring (TDM), i.e., the quantification of serum or plasma concentrations of medications for dose optimization, has proven a valuable tool for the patient-matched psychopharmacotherapy. Uncertain drug adherence, suboptimal tolerability, non-response at therapeutic doses, or pharmacokinetic drug-drug interactions are typical situations when measurement of medication concentrations is helpful. Patient populations that may predominantly benefit from TDM in psychiatry are children, pregnant women, elderly patients, individuals with intelligence disabilities, forensic patients, patients with known or suspected genetically determined pharmacokinetic abnormalities or individuals with pharmacokinetically relevant comorbidities. However, the potential benefits of TDM for optimization of pharmacotherapy can only be obtained if the method is adequately integrated into the clinical treatment process. To promote an appropriate use of TDM, the TDM expert group of the Arbeitsgemeinschaft für Neuropsychopharmakologie und Pharmakopsychiatrie (AGNP) issued guidelines for TDM in psychiatry in 2004. Since then, knowledge has advanced significantly, and new psychopharmacologic agents have been introduced that are also candidates for TDM. Therefore the TDM consensus guidelines were updated and extended to 128 neuropsychiatric drugs. 4 levels of recommendation for using TDM were defined ranging from "strongly recommended" to "potentially useful". Evidence-based "therapeutic reference ranges" and "dose related reference ranges" were elaborated after an extensive literature search and a structured internal review process. A "laboratory alert level" was introduced, i.e., a plasma level at or above which the laboratory should immediately inform the treating physician. Supportive information such as cytochrome P450 substrateand inhibitor properties of medications, normal ranges of ratios of concentrations of drug metabolite to parent drug and recommendations for the interpretative services are given. Recommendations when to combine TDM with pharmacogenetic tests are also provided. Following the guidelines will help to improve the outcomes of psychopharmacotherapy of many patients especially in case of pharmacokinetic problems. Thereby, one should never forget that TDM is an interdisciplinary task that sometimes requires the respectful discussion of apparently discrepant data so that, ultimately, the patient can profit from such a joint effort.
